Fast checklist: Is this a true drain emergency?
Not all clogs are equal. Use this quick test to decide if you should call now.
- Multiple drains backing up at once
- Toilets gurgle when you run a sink, or showers fill when you flush. This often points to a main sewer blockage.
- Sewage smell or visible backup
- Sewage odor from a floor drain or toilet is a health risk and needs urgent help.
- Water on floors or near walls
- Standing water can damage cabinets, drywall, or flooring in minutes.
- No drain relief after a few attempts
- If you tried a plunger and basic steps with no improvement, stop and call.
- You only have one working bathroom
- Loss of function makes it urgent, especially with kids or guests.
If two or more items apply, treat it as an emergency. Turn off affected fixtures and call for help.
What to try safely before you call
If there is no sewage backup and only one fixture is slow, try these steps.
- Plunge correctly
- Use a cup plunger for sinks and a flange plunger for toilets. Cover overflow holes with a wet rag to keep pressure focused.
- Reset the trap
- For sinks, place a bucket under the P-trap and remove it. Clear debris and reinstall. Do not over-tighten the slip nuts.
- Use enzyme cleaners, not harsh chemicals
- Enzyme or bacterial cleaners can help with organic buildup. Skip caustic drain chemicals. They can damage pipes and are dangerous if later hydro-jetted.
- Flush with hot water
- After clearing hair or soap scum, run hot water for several minutes to move remaining debris.
- Try a small hand auger
- A 15 to 25 foot hand snake can break local clogs. Stop if you feel you are kinking the cable or scratching fixtures.
If you see gray water rising, smell sewage, or hear toilet gurgling, stop DIY and call.
When to call a plumber now
Some symptoms mean you should bring in a pro immediately.
- Gurgling from drains or toilets when using water elsewhere
- More than one slow or backed-up drain at the same time
- Sewer odors indoors or outdoors
- Overflow from a floor drain, shower, or tub
- Repeat clogs in the same fixture within weeks
- Water stains or pooling near the slab or in the yard
These signs often point to a deeper issue in the main line. A licensed plumber can verify the cause with a camera inspection, identify roots, scale, or a broken section, and clear or repair the line safely.
Why emergencies happen in Las Vegas homes
Las Vegas plumbing has a few local quirks that drive clogs.
- Hard water scale
- Our mineral-heavy water leaves deposits that catch grease and hair. Over time, this narrows drain pipes and traps debris.
- Desert soil and settling
- Caliche and shifting soil can stress older sewer lines. Small offsets let roots or debris snag and grow.
- Mature landscape roots
- Established trees in older neighborhoods like Paradise and Winchester can penetrate tiny cracks in clay or cast-iron lines.
- Popular remodels and disposals
- Kitchen updates often add powerful disposals. Grease, fibrous foods, and coffee grounds still cause clogs, even with strong disposals.
Knowing the local causes helps us choose the right fix the first time.

Solutions that fix the root cause
Clogs often return because only the symptom was treated. Here is how we solve the source.
- Drain clearing vs drain cleaning
- Clearing pushes through a clog so water can flow. Cleaning restores pipe walls. We recommend cleaning when grease, scale, or roots are present.
- Rooter service
- Mechanical cutters break through roots and heavy blockages. This is effective for immediate relief. If roots keep returning, we discuss line repair or lining.
- Hydro-jetting
- High-pressure water scours the full pipe circumference. It removes grease, scale, and sludge far better than a cable. This helps prevent quick re-clogs, especially in kitchen lines.
- Camera inspection
- We document the inside of your line to confirm the fix and identify any broken or offset sections.
- Repair or replacement
- If we find severe corrosion, cracks, or a collapsed section, we present options. That can include spot repair, traditional replacement, or trenchless methods when suitable.

Prevention playbook: keep drains flowing
Simple habits protect your drains and budget.
- Kitchen best practices
- Wipe grease into the trash, not the sink. Avoid fibrous foods like celery and onion skins. Use cold water with your disposal to keep fats firm.
- Bathroom routines
- Use hair catchers in showers. Run hot water after soapy baths. Keep wipes and cotton products out of toilets, even if labeled flushable.
- Seasonal checkups
- Schedule annual or semiannual drain cleaning if you have trees near the sewer line or a history of grease buildup.
- Water quality help
- Consider a whole-home conditioner to reduce scale. Less scale means fewer catch points for debris in drains.

How to decide in the moment: a quick decision tree
Use this simple flow when you are unsure.
- Is sewage backing up or do you smell sewage?
- Yes: Stop using water and call now.
- No: Go to step 2.
- Are two or more drains affected?
- Yes: Likely a main line issue. Call now.
- No: Go to step 3.
- Did plunging and trap cleaning fail?
- Yes: Call a pro to avoid damage.
- No: Monitor. If symptoms return within a week, schedule an inspection.
When in doubt, call. A quick diagnostic can prevent water damage and bigger bills.

Should I use chemical drain cleaners?
Avoid harsh chemicals. They can damage pipes, harm finishes, and react dangerously if we later hydro-jet the line. Use a plunger, remove the P-trap, or try enzyme cleaners. Call a pro if the clog returns.

What if the clog keeps coming back?
Recurring clogs usually mean grease, scale, roots, or a damaged pipe. We recommend hydro-jetting and a camera inspection to confirm the cause. If the line is damaged, we will review repair or trenchless options.
